در مقاله “آموزش جامع نصب و پیکر بندی Google XML Sitemap در وردپرس” بیشتر در مورد یکی از راه های بهبود سئو می پردازیم :

چگونه افزونه ی نقشه سایت XML گوگل را برای وردپرس نصب و پیکربندی کنیم؟

هدف نهایی تمامی استراتژی های SEO تسلط بالای موتورهای جستجو است. پیش از مطرح شدن SEO، وب سایت ها نیاز به اندیس گذاری داشتند. در واقع اندیس گذاری به معنی این است که محتوای شما توسط موتور جستجو تشخیص داده شود و از طریق عبارت های جستجوی مرتبط کشف شود. اگر هدف شما مطرح شدت سایتتان توسط موتورهای جست و جو باشد، اندیس گذاری منظم توسط لینک های گوگل ضروری است.

اندیس گذاری وب سایت شما نیازمند بازدید ربات های گوگل از سایت شماست. این ربات ها به جستجوی تمام صفحات وب می پردازند. هنگامی که یک محتوای جدید یا بروز شده شناسایی شد، آدرس آن به موتورهای جستجو منتقل می شود تا اندیس گذاری انجام شود.

پس از اندیس گذاری، سایت شما به تدریج در SERPs ظاهر می شود. در حال حاضر استراتژی های SEO بهترین روش ها برای افزایش رتبه سایت شما می باشند و اندیس گذاری گام اول در استراتژی های SEO است.

ساده ترین راه برای دریافت اندیس گذاری وب سایت، ساخت یک نقشه سایت XML و سپس ثبت نام آن در کنسول جستجوی گوگل می باشد. خوشبختانه، این کار برای کاربران وردپرس به لطف افزونه بسیار عالی نقشه ی سایت XML گوگل آسان شده است.

افزونه نقشه ی سایت XML گوگل، توسط Arne Brachhold خلق شده و در دسترس قرار داده شده است. شما می تواند آن را به صورت رایگان از مخزن وردپرس دانلود کنید. بد نیست بدانید که این افزونه در مخزن ورد پرس با داشتن رتبه ۴.۹ از ۵ و ۱۸ میلیون دانلود دارای امتیاز بالایی است.

امروز، ما قصد داریم به شما نشان دهیم که چگونه این افزونه فوق العاده را نصب و پیکربندی کنید.

نقشه سایت XML چیست؟

اول، اجازه دهید به این سوال پاسخ دهیم: یک نقشه سایت XML چیست؟

نقشه سایت یک نمای کلی از ساختار وب سایت شما فراهم می کند. این نقشه به موتورهای جستجو کمک می کند تا تمام محتوای شما از جمله آدرس های جدید و پست های بروز شده را کشف کنند .

موتورهای جستجو با پیروی از نقشه سایت شما می توانند آن را اندیس گذاری کنند، (مگر اینکه شما تگ noindex برای یک صفحه استفاده کنید.) این به این معنی است که نقشه ی سایت تنها راه برای تضمین این است که تمامی محتوای لازم توسط موتور جستجو تشخیص داده شده است.

چگونه نقشه سایت XML را نصب کنیم؟

اگر تا به حال هیچ افزونه ای در وردپرس نصب نکرده اید نگران نباشید. فرایند نصب بسیار ساده است.

به پیشخوان وردپرس خود وارد شوید، سپس به قسمت افزونه ها رفته و گزینه ی افزودن افزونه را انتخاب کنید. سپس در نوار جستجو عبارت “Google XML Sitemaps” را تایپ کنید. افزونه های زیادی با نام مشابه وجود دارند، بنابراین مطمئن شوید که افزونه ی درست را انتخاب کرده اید (به دنبال افزونه ای باشید که توسط Arne Brachhold نوشته شده است).

زمانی که آن را پیدا کردید، بر روی آن را نصب کرده و سپس فعال کنید. و یا می توانید از اینجا این افزونه را دانلود کنید و به صورت دستی آن را در وردپرس آپلود و فعال کنید.

به این صورت کار تمام می شود. به محض این که شما این افزونه را فعال کردید، این افزونه تضمین می کند که نقشه سایت شما به طور خودکار تولید و یک تصویر از وضعیت فعلی آن تهیه شود. شما می توانید با اضافه کردن پسوند /sitemap.xml به دامنه نقشه سایت خود را خود ببینید.

نقشه سایت شما تمامی URL های شما را با توجه به سطح اولویت و تغییر فرکانس لیست می کند.

چگونه نقشه سایت XML گوگل را پیکربندی کنیم؟

حال نوبت به پیکربندی افزونه جدید می رسد. تمام تنظیمات این افزونه از یک صفحه کنترل می شود- به قسمت Setting رفته و بر روی XML-Sitemap کلیک کنید. خوشبختانه، این افزونه با یک مجموعه از پیش تنظیماتی است که شما می توانید تنظیمات را به همان صورت که هستند نگه دارید. هرچند شخصا ترجیح میدهم که کمی بیشتر درمورد نحوه کار این افزونه توضیح دهم، تا بتوانید آن را بر اساس نیازمندی های خود پیکربندی کنید. اگر شما نیز مانند من فکر می کنید تمام تنظیمات اصلی این بخش را مطالعه کنید.

بلافاصله پس از نصب، شما ممکن است پیام زیر را در بالای صفحه نمایش ببینید: “موتورهای جستجو هنوز مطلع نشده اند.”

اگر می خواهید با بیشترین سرعت ممکن سایت شما اندیس گذاری شود، بر روی لینک notify search engines about your sitemap کلیک کنید. این کار نقشه ی سایت شما را به دو موتور جستجوی اصلی یعنی گوگل و Bing معرفی می کند. یک ثانیه بعد، این افزونه به شما می گوید که فرایند معرفی با موفقیت انجام شده است. شما اکنون می توانید انتظار بازدید از یک ربات گوگل را داشته باشید و محتوای شما خیلی زود اندیس گذاری می شود.

حالا به صفحه تنظیمات برگردیم، که به هفت بخش تقسیم می شود. اجازه دهید که بصورت مختصر و مفید آنچه به کمک این افزونه می توانید انجام دهید را توضیح دهم.

  • گزینه های اصلی

همانطور که از نام آن مشخص است، بخش اول کنترل پیکربندی های اصلی را به عهده دارد.

برای شروع، شما می توانید انتخاب کنید که کدام موتورهای جستجو از بروز رسانی سایت شما مطلع شوند. توصیه من بنده این است چک باکس گوگل و Bing حتما تیک داشته باشد. هر بار که شما یک پست جدید منتشر می کنید و یا مطالب قدیمی را ویرایش می کنید، روند معرفی تکرار می شود.

گزینه بعدی نقشه سایت شما را به فایل robot.txt اضافه می کند. در حال حاضر، یک فایل robot.txt به طور خاص برای برقراری ارتباط با موتور جستجو ساخته می شود. این فایل به خصوص برای موتورهای جستجویی که اعلان های ping را پشتیبانی نمی کنند مفید است. به این ترتیب، توصیه می کنم چک باکس robot.txt تیک دار باشد.

گزینه ی بعدی Advanced Option است. دو مورد اول در مورد میزان محدودیت حافظه و زمان اجراست، از آن ها عبور کنید. سپس از شما خواسته می شود به پیکربندی برگه صفات XSLT بپردازید. اگر میخواهید که نقشه ی سایت شما زیبا به نظر برسد، می توانید یک صفحه ی صفات XSLT جدید آپلود کنید. یا اگر می خواهید کمتر خواندنی باشد می توانید XSLT را کلا غیر فعال کنید (نگران نباشید – موتورهای جستجو هنوز می توانند آن را به خوبی بخوانند).

گزینه بعدی و شاید مهم ترین گزینه در این بخش گزینه ی override the base URL of the sitemap است.

در حال حاضر، به طور پیش فرض، نقشه سایت شما در فرمت /sitemap.xml ظاهر خواهد شد. به عنوان مثال، domain.com/sitemap.xml.

اما اجازه دهید به شما بگویم که وب سایت خود را به زیر بخش هایی تقسیم کنید.

  1. دامنه ی ریشه: com
  2. زیر-آدرس: com/blog/

مورد نهایی تنظیم نسخه HTML نقشه سایت تان برای رباتهای ساده تری است که نمی توانند XML را درک کنند. این موضوع برای همه ی موتورهای جستجوی بزرگ اعمال نمی شود، اگر می خواهید در موتور جست و جوی خاصی اندیس گذاری شود، آن را تیک دار کنید

  • صفحات اضافی

صفحات اضافی تنها با استفاده از زیر آدرس ها و زیر دامنه ها قابل اجرا هستند. و به شما اجازه می دهد تا صفحات اضافی را نیز برای افزودن به نقشه سایت تان مشخص کنید.

به عنوان مثال، اگر شما وبلاگ خود را در فرم domain.com/blog/ اجرا کنید، و همچنین بخواهید صفحه ی خانگی domain.com، را در نقشه سایت زیر آدرس خود قرار دهید، فقط روی Add new page کلیک کنید و دستورات ساده را دنبال کنید. شما باید آدرس، سطح اولویت، تغییر فرکانس، و تاریخ آخرین تغییر آدرس را مشخص کنید.

  • اولویت ارسال

حال ما Post Priority را داریم. برای این که بهتر این بخش را متوجه شوید، اجازه دهید تا به سرعت سطوح اولویت SEO را معرفی کنم.

در حال حاضر، سطوح اولویت یک بخش بسیار مهم در نقشه سایت شما هستند. آن ها ارتباط بین محتوای مهم شما را با موتورهای جستجو برقرار می کنند. هر صفحه وب با توجه به اهمیت آن سطح اولویتی بین ۰ تا ۱ دارد.

ممکن است فکر کنید: خوب، سایت من فوق العاده مهم است، بنابراین من قصد دارم به تمام آدرس ها حداکثر اولویت ۱ را بدهم.

باید بگویم که این کار چندان عاقلانه نیست!

سطح اولویت یک URL نسبت به سایر URL های داخلی در نظر گرفته شده است. اگر شما به همه آنها اولویت یکسان بدهید – حتی حداکثر اولویت – در واقع به موتور جستجو می گویید تمام صفحات شما دارای ارزش یکسانی هستند. و سوال اینجایت: آیا واقعا صفحه ی اصلی شما ارزشی برابر با ارزش یک پست نه چندان مهم در وبلاگتان را داراست؟ البته که نه. بنابراین کمی نظم داشته باشید، و در تعیین سطح اولویت معقول باشید.

برگردیم به تنظیمات. در این بخش بیان می کنیم که چگونه برای هر پست سطح اولویتی تعیین کنیم. برای این کار سه گزینه وجود دارد:

  1. اتوماتیک – از محاسبه اولویت بصورت اتوماتیک استفاده نکنید. این کار باعث می شود همه ی پست ها دارای ارزش یکسانی باشند.
  2. تعداد نظرات – اولویت بر اساس تعداد نظراتی یک پست دریافت می کند محاسبه می شود.
  3. متوسط نظرات – اولویت بر اساس تعداد نظرات نسبت به پست های دیگر محاسبه می شود.

اگر نظر من را بخواهید پیشنهاد می کنم از یکی از محاسبات مبتنی بر نظرات استفاده کنید. این به این معناست که پست های محبوب شما به طور خودکار سطح اولویت بالاتری دریافت خواهند کرد.

  • محتوای نقشه ی سایت

بخش محتوای سایت به شما اجازه می دهد تا انتخاب کنید که  چه آیتم ها، انواع پست سفارشی و چه طبقه بندی هایی در نقشه سایت شما وجود داشته باشد.

به عنوان مثال، حتما صفحه اصلی باید وجود داشته باشد. همچنین ایده خوبیست اگر همه پست های وردپرس شما، صفحات و نوع پست سفارشی در نقشه سایت وجود داشته باشند. اگر نمی خواهید که این صفحات در SERPs ظاهر شود مطمئن شوید که از حالت انتخاب خارج شده اند.

در پایین این بخش، شما می توانید گزینه های بیشتر را ببینید. این بخش از شما می پرسد که آیا می خواهید آخرین تاریخ تغییرات را شامل شود یا خیر. من توصیه می کنم تیک آن را بزنید، در غیر این صورت موتورهای جستجو تنها مطالب جدید را جستجو می کنند و با محتوای بروز شده و یا ویرایش شده کاری ندارند.

  • موارد کنار گذاشته شده

ممکن است بخواهید نقشه ی سایتتان شامل غالب پست های شما باشد، اما نه همه آنها. این قسمت به شما امکان حذف یک دسته به همراه پست های فردی و صفحات از نقشه سایت، را با وارد کردن شماره ID تان می دهد.

  •  فرکانس تغییر

ما فرکانس تغییر  را در سراسر این پست ذکر کرده ایم، اما در این بخش شما می توانید مقادیر را برای آن ها تعریف کنید.

در حال حاضر، تغییر فرکانس به موتور های جست و جو اجازه می دهد که بدانند که چگونه اغلب محتوا تغییر می کند. این اطلاعات به موتورهای جستجو می گوید که چه زمانی آن ها نیاز به بررسی به روز رسانی صفحات دارند.

اگر شما یک وب سایت استاتیک دارید که به ندرت تغییر می کند، گزینه ی روزانه مناسب نیست. در این سناریو، گزینه ی سالانه واقعی تر است. گزینه های همیشه، ساعتی، روزانه، هفتگی، ماهانه، سالانه، و هرگز در این بخش وجود دارند.

به یاد داشته باشید، همیشه بررسی ها به صورتی که انتخاب کرده اید دقیق نخواهد بود، انتظار نداریم که رباتها مانند ساعت، دقیق باشند.

  • اولویت

پیش تر به سطوح اولویت ارسال پرداخته ایم، اما این بخش به شما این امکان داده می شود که مطالبتان را از نظر سطح اهمیت رتبه بندی کنید. شما همچنین باید مقادیر حداکثر و حداقل پست های وبلاگ را مشخص کنید.

صفحه اصلی سایت شما احتمالا مهم ترین صفحه شماست – بنابراین به آن حداکثر نمره ۱ را بدهید. صفحات استاتیک و پست های وبلاگ متداول به احتمال زیاد رتبه ی بعدی اهمیت را برای شما داشته باشند، بنابراین به آن ها نیز نمره ی ۰ را بدهید.

فقط به یاد داشته باشید: به محتوای بی اهمیت نمره ی بسیار زیاد ندهید. تعیین سطح اولویت از مسائل بسیار مهم می باشد.

افکار نهایی

در این مقاله با نگاهی دقیق به بررسی نحوه ی پیکربندی افزونه ی نقشه ی سایت XML گوگل پرداختیم. این افزونه رایگان است و بسیار محبوب است – و در مخزن وردپرس دارای امتیاز بالایی می باشد. که احتمالا به دلیل قابلیتهای ارزشمند افزونه ی نقشه ی سایت XML و راه اندازی بسیار ساده این افزونه می باشد.

یکی از نقاط قوت این افزونه این است که تنظیمات پیش فرض مناسبی دارد. این به این معناست که می توانید به سادگی آن را نصب کنید و بدون این که تنظیمات پیکربندی آن را تغییر دهید از آن استفاده کنید. با این حال، این افزونه دارای تنظیمات متفاوتی است، بنابراین شما می توانید نقشه سایت خود را به میل خود تغییر دهید.

به طور کلی، یک افزونه ی واقعا استثنایی – و مسلما یکی از بهترین افزونه های نقشه سایت وردپرس می باشد.